Are you an Electrical Fitter looking to join a skilled and dedicated Maintenance team with a leading manufacturer? If so, this could be the role for you

With over 50 years of leading manufacturing experience, this well-established company is needing to expand their Maintenance Team, resulting in the need for this role.


Key roles:

  • To carry out all the duties and responsibilities of a Maintenance Fitter, Electrical
  • To provide advisory and expert focus for all electronic aspects linked to the full range of site maintenance department activities, for example with the design control/operating programs for CNC systems on new & existing production equipment
  • Establish and fully maintain all associated record systems, whether hard copy of bespoke computer software orientated
  • To maintain, service, repair and calibrate all electronic devices such as Computer Numerical Control Machinery, Programmable Controllers and Electronic Gauging Equipment
  • To assist in electronic design, fabrication of machinery and test equipment as required by the Company

Essential experience and skills:

  • Electrical Apprenticeship
  • Previous experience with manufacturing technologies, machines (including CNC processes) chemical plants, site and facilities management
  • Previous experience of working in a busy manufacturing environment
  • Communicates clearly, concisely and effectively, both verbally and in writing, sharing information with confidence, enthusiasm and with an impact that promotes understanding
  • Electrical circuitry machinery/factory services
  • Machine Tool Electronics and PLC experience
  • Latest Edition Wiring Regulations (BS7671)
